Enabling a VM that has been migrated to a new host

After I migrate a VM to a new host (offline), the VM information remains on the source host but everything gets disabled (modify, runnable, visible statuses are all set to disabled).

Is it possible to manually change all these values to enabled without migrating the VM back? I know it's technically possible with the hpvmmodify options, but would the VM actually boot successfully? Assuming I have already shutdown and disabled the VM on the other host. All storage is visible to both hosts all the time.

Re: Enabling a VM that has been migrated to a new host

Yes. The only problem would be if the guest would run at the same time on both sides. If you ensure that's not the case, you can enable what you need using hpvmodify and start it.
